Sump Pump Installation in Warwick, RI
Sump pump installation services involve setting up a device designed to remove excess water from basements or crawl spaces, helping to prevent flooding and water damage. These systems are typically installed in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high groundwater levels, and they work by automatically activating when water levels rise, directing water away from the property to prevent pooling and structural issues. Homeowners often request sump pump installation when constructing a new basement, upgrading an existing drainage system, or addressing ongoing water intrusion problems to maintain a dry and safe living environment.
Before requesting sump pump installation, property owners usually want to understand the different types of pumps available, such as pedestal or submersible models, and which is best suited for their property’s needs. It’s also important to consider the location for installation, the capacity required to handle heavy water flow, and any additional drainage components that may be necessary for optimal performance. Clarifying these details can help ensure the system functions effectively and provides reliable protection against basement flooding and moisture issues.

Sump Pump Installation Questions
What is a sump pump? A sump pump is a device installed in a basement or crawl space to remove excess water and prevent flooding during heavy rain or groundwater rise.
Why install a sump pump? Installing a sump pump helps protect a property from water damage, mold growth, and foundation issues caused by excess moisture.
Where should a sump pump be installed? A sump pump is typically installed in a sump basin or pit located in the lowest part of the basement or crawl space.
What types of sump pumps are available? Common types include pedestal and submersible pumps, each suited for different space and noise considerations.
